Mastering Spring Profiles: Annotations and Practical Examples Explained

  Рет қаралды 4,922

CodeSnippet

CodeSnippet

Күн бұрын

Пікірлер: 33
@venkatchundru9844
@venkatchundru9844 25 күн бұрын
🎯 Key points for quick navigation: 24:38 *You can use the `@Profile` annotation to specify beans for different environments in Spring.* 24:53 *Multiple profiles can be specified using comma-separated values, but only one profile will be picked based on the order in the configuration.* 25:07 *When multiple profiles are active, beans for both profiles may be initialized, but the profile at the end of the list is the one that is selected.* 25:47 *Changing the order of active profiles will change which configuration is picked, as the profile at the end is given priority.* 26:03 *If both `Dev` and `Prod` profiles are active, the beans marked with both profiles are injected based on the profile order.* 26:31 *You can externalize configuration using the command line to specify multiple profiles, influencing which properties are injected based on their order.* 27:14 *The `@Profile` annotation is essential for managing environment-specific configurations in Spring Boot applications.* Made with HARPA AI
@venkatchundru9844
@venkatchundru9844 25 күн бұрын
🎯 Key points for quick navigation: 24:24 *The `@Profile` annotation is used to conditionally inject beans based on the active Spring profile.* 24:38 *You can specify multiple profiles in the `spring.profiles.active` property, but only one profile at the end will be applied.* 25:07 *When multiple profiles are active, the profile listed last in the properties file takes precedence.* 26:03 *Changing the order of profiles in the configuration file affects which profile's beans are injected.* 26:18 *Both profiles can be active at the same time, leading to the injection of beans from both profiles.* 26:46 *Profiles can be specified externally, allowing you to use different configurations for different environments.* 27:14 *The `@Profile` annotation enables the use of different configurations for different environments in Spring Boot applications.* Made with HARPA AI
@acharan7973
@acharan7973 8 күн бұрын
I think when we use @Profile on a particular class, the bean for that particular class will be created in the context-container if we select that particular profile rather than saying we are initializing it. Correct me if i am wrong.
@rollno.66bmsvatikatiwari91
@rollno.66bmsvatikatiwari91 2 ай бұрын
Perfect video to prepare for interview
@CodeSnippetByChetanGhate
@CodeSnippetByChetanGhate 2 ай бұрын
🙌
@AnkitKumar-se8fv
@AnkitKumar-se8fv 6 ай бұрын
Crystal clear video bhaiya, loving this series
@CodeSnippetByChetanGhate
@CodeSnippetByChetanGhate 6 ай бұрын
Thanks bhai ♥️
@shamimahamed8333
@shamimahamed8333 4 ай бұрын
You can make some lectures over spring, because you are the best❤❤❤
@CodeSnippetByChetanGhate
@CodeSnippetByChetanGhate 4 ай бұрын
Thanks 🙏
@prathameshchaudhari1337
@prathameshchaudhari1337 6 ай бұрын
Keep it Up, Short-Simple-On_Point 👍
@CodeSnippetByChetanGhate
@CodeSnippetByChetanGhate 6 ай бұрын
Sure, Thanks 🙏 ♥️❤️
@AshVlogs-224
@AshVlogs-224 6 ай бұрын
That's the perfect and clear one..!
@CodeSnippetByChetanGhate
@CodeSnippetByChetanGhate 6 ай бұрын
Thanks 🙏
@Abdullah-i6n3w
@Abdullah-i6n3w 6 ай бұрын
Keep up your good work brother 👌👌👌👌
@CodeSnippetByChetanGhate
@CodeSnippetByChetanGhate 6 ай бұрын
Thanks bro ❤️
@anushakollikonda8363
@anushakollikonda8363 2 ай бұрын
It is also we need to change right
@balamanikandank3016
@balamanikandank3016 6 ай бұрын
Good work brother🔥
@CodeSnippetByChetanGhate
@CodeSnippetByChetanGhate 6 ай бұрын
Thanks bro ❤️
@abhishekbs4098
@abhishekbs4098 6 ай бұрын
Very useful
@CodeSnippetByChetanGhate
@CodeSnippetByChetanGhate 6 ай бұрын
Thanks
@mohitshoww
@mohitshoww 6 ай бұрын
Nice , How can i manage different snapshot repositories or release repositories based on profile , is there any way ?
@CodeSnippetByChetanGhate
@CodeSnippetByChetanGhate 5 ай бұрын
Yes, you can manage different snapshot or release repositories based on profiles in Spring Boot by using Maven's profile feature. Define different profiles in your pom.xml file for each environment, specifying the repository settings. Then, activate the appropriate profile when building your project.
@mohitshoww
@mohitshoww 5 ай бұрын
@@CodeSnippetByChetanGhatecan u please make one short video or small video on this it will be helpful
@CodeSnippetByChetanGhate
@CodeSnippetByChetanGhate 5 ай бұрын
@@mohitshoww sure
@Raksha0827
@Raksha0827 6 ай бұрын
Create more spring boot classes
@truth_teller9648
@truth_teller9648 27 күн бұрын
Please don't use RIGHT after every sentence. 🙏 Everything else is very good 🙏 Keep doing more videos.
@CodeSnippetByChetanGhate
@CodeSnippetByChetanGhate 27 күн бұрын
Sure thanks 🙏
@Sumeshkumarback
@Sumeshkumarback 6 ай бұрын
Try to clear the concept below 20 minutes. I mean create short content
@CodeSnippetByChetanGhate
@CodeSnippetByChetanGhate 6 ай бұрын
Sure. Perhaps you can also increase the video speed to 1.5x
@Sumeshkumarback
@Sumeshkumarback 6 ай бұрын
@@CodeSnippetByChetanGhate why my comments got Removed
@livannani2253
@livannani2253 6 ай бұрын
@@CodeSnippetByChetanGhate😂
@sopparikrishna173
@sopparikrishna173 6 ай бұрын
After This Make Videos On Security Also Brother, I have watched so many videos I didn't get it but the way of explanation very understandable brother 🫡🫡
@CodeSnippetByChetanGhate
@CodeSnippetByChetanGhate 6 ай бұрын
Sure 👍🏻
Handle 1,000,000 Threads with Java and Spring Boot !!!
21:50
Daily Code Buffer
Рет қаралды 30 М.
Cheerleader Transformation That Left Everyone Speechless! #shorts
00:27
Fabiosa Best Lifehacks
Рет қаралды 16 МЛН
“Don’t stop the chances.”
00:44
ISSEI / いっせい
Рет қаралды 62 МЛН
小丑教训坏蛋 #小丑 #天使 #shorts
00:49
好人小丑
Рет қаралды 54 МЛН
Java Spring Boot Interview | 2+ Years Experience
30:01
GenZ Career
Рет қаралды 22 М.
Cheerleader Transformation That Left Everyone Speechless! #shorts
00:27
Fabiosa Best Lifehacks
Рет қаралды 16 МЛН